Protect the People — Exit Grant

Visit Grantee Site
  • Category: Global Health & Wellbeing
  • Focus Area: Immigration Policy
  • Organization Name: Protect the People
  • Amount: $50,000

  • Award Date: October 2016

Table of Contents

    Grant investigator: Alexander Berger
    This page was reviewed but not written by the grant investigator. Protect the People staff also reviewed this page prior to publication.

    The Open Philanthropy Project recommended $50,000 to Protect the People, as an exit grant to close out our support of its program helping workers from Haiti to access seasonal work in the U.S. We wrote a more detailed update on the program and this grant decision on this page.
